A window to corporate data — straight from Google Sheets

Push governed Data Marts to a Sheet on a schedule, or let business users pull them on demand from inside Google Sheets. Joinable columns work in both pathways — without a line of SQL.

app.owox.com/data-marts/spreadsheet-reporting
Build a library of reusable data marts
Trusted, proven, recognized

Trusted by 170,000 spreadsheet users

170K+
Users trust OWOX[1]
Analysts, marketers, and data teams across 20+ industries
4.9★
Rating on G2[2]
“A trusted data analytics partner” — verified review
365K+
Data marts delivered
Created and served by OWOX to business users
79K
npm installs[3]
Self-hosted OWOX Community Edition on GitHub
One Feature, Two Pathways

Spreadsheet reporting that finally fits your team

The data team pushes governed Data Marts to a Sheet on a schedule. Business users open Sheets and pull what they need on demand. Both work from the same source, with joined columns included.

THE ANALYST

Push governed data, not CSV dumps

Pick a Data Mart, choose columns (including joined ones from Joinable Data Marts), set a schedule. The destination Sheet stays fresh — no manual exports, no copy-pasting.

Push governed data, not CSV dumps
01Available in every edition. No row limits.
THE BUSINESS USER

Pull live data without leaving your Sheet

Open the OWOX extension, browse the marts your data team has approved, and pull them in. Joined columns appear right next to native ones — the data team already wired the relationships.

Pull live data without leaving your Sheet
02Cloud editions. Browse, pull, refresh — all in Sheets.
Live spreadsheet reporting, governed by your data team
Excel coming soon. The same governed Data Marts will flow into both, with the same joinable columns and the same trust.
For Data Teams

Push governed data, not CSV dumps

Pick a Data Mart, choose columns including joined ones, set a schedule — governed logic flows into Sheets with zero manual exports.

Push a Data Mart to any Sheet

Pick a governed Data Mart from the OWOX UI, choose the destination Sheet, and OWOX writes the data on a schedule. No CSV exports, no copy-paste, no manual refresh.

Pick a governed Data Mart from the OWOX UI, choose the destination Sheet, and OWOX writes the data on a schedule. No CSV exports, no copy-paste, no manual refresh.

Include joined columns — no SQL at export time

Pull native and joined fields into the same Sheet, in one click. Blend Ads spend with CRM revenue or marketing data with product usage — without writing the join yourself.

Pull native and joined fields into the same Sheet, in one click. Blend Ads spend with CRM revenue or marketing data with product usage — without writing the join yourself.

Schedule it once. Always fresh.

Set hourly, daily, weekly, or custom refresh schedules. Your Sheet updates overnight; stakeholders open it in the morning and the numbers are already current.

Set hourly, daily, weekly, or custom refresh schedules. Your Sheet updates overnight; stakeholders open it in the morning and the numbers are already current.
Pick a governed Data Mart from the OWOX UI, choose the destination Sheet, and OWOX writes the data on a schedule. No CSV exports, no copy-paste, no manual refresh.
Pull native and joined fields into the same Sheet, in one click. Blend Ads spend with CRM revenue or marketing data with product usage — without writing the join yourself.
Set hourly, daily, weekly, or custom refresh schedules. Your Sheet updates overnight; stakeholders open it in the morning and the numbers are already current.
For Business Teams

Pull live data without leaving your Sheet

Open the OWOX extension, browse approved Data Marts, and pull native or joined columns into your Sheet — no SQL, no tickets.

Your data marts, already inside Google Sheets

Open the OWOX extension, browse the Data Marts your data team has made available, and pull them into your Sheet – no warehouse login, no SQL, no ticket.

Open the OWOX extension, browse the Data Marts your data team has made available, and pull them into your Sheet – no warehouse login, no SQL, no ticket.

Pick a Data Mart, pick columns — including joined ones

Native and joined columns appear in the same picker. Combine ads, CRM, and product data without writing a single query — and never wait on the data team for a blend.

Native and joined columns appear in the same picker. Combine ads, CRM, and product data without writing a single query — and never wait on the data team for a blend.

Keep data fresh

Schedule updates exactly when you need the data to arrive. No slack pings, no tickets, no waiting. Just fresh data arriving to your meeting.

Schedule updates exactly when you need the data to arrive. No slack pings, no tickets, no waiting. Just fresh data arriving to your meeting.
Open the OWOX extension, browse the Data Marts your data team has made available, and pull them into your Sheet – no warehouse login, no SQL, no ticket.
Native and joined columns appear in the same picker. Combine ads, CRM, and product data without writing a single query — and never wait on the data team for a blend.
Schedule updates exactly when you need the data to arrive. No slack pings, no tickets, no waiting. Just fresh data arriving to your meeting.
step-by-step

How our data collection works?

Step 1: Add Your Data Storage

Decide where do you want your data to be stored - any data warehouse

Step 2: Select data source

Choose your app, give necessary permissions to account.

Step 3: Configure the fields

Select the fields your want to import. You can get the fields available in the API.

Step 4: Run & get your data

You're ready to go. Run connectors & set update frequency.

Step 5: Connect more sources

You don't want single-source reports, right? Collect more data!

Step 6: Configure Data Marts

Build a collection of data marts: SQL, tables, views or connectors.

Step 7: Connect BI Tools & more

Select a data destination: Sheets, Looker Studio, Email or Chat tools.

Step 8: Run AI Insights

Get focused on data insights, set delivery and forget about routine.

Editions

Push is free in every edition. Extension included in Cloud.

The easiest to get started

Starter

OWOX Cloud

Try before you scale

Starter

$30/mo — no credit card required

For data professionals & teams starting to automate reporting

Create data marts from your DWH
Create data marts from external sources (Meta, Google, TikTok Ads...)
Sync data marts to Spreadsheets and Looker Studio
Automate data refreshes
15 credits / mo included
Get Started Free

MOST POPULAR

Team

OWOX Cloud

Best for teams

Team

Starts at $875/mo + $35/seat (5 seats included)

For small and mid-size teams looking to automate collaborative reporting & get AI insights

Everything in Starter, plus:
Automate AI Insights to Email, Google Chat, Microsoft Teams, or Slack
Share credits across seats
500 credits / mo included
Set up data marts in Multiple Projects
Talk to Sales
Enterprise Cloud

OWOX Cloud

Ultimate control in the cloud

Enterprise

Custom contract

For organizations looking for a tailored solution with an extra layer of flexibility, security & support included

Chat with data in your corporate messenger
Advanced User Management
Monitoring & Advanced Logging
SSO & SLA
Customer Success Manager
Talk to Sales
Why teams pick OWOX

Everything business needs

Outcomes your company gets the moment your data marts go live.

No SQL? No problem.

Empower business users to explore and build reports on their own – no code, no bottlenecks.

Dashboards, no delay

Give client-facing teams instant access to dashboards – without needing analyst help or waiting in line.

Instant answers, zero tickets

Ask questions and get answers right away – in Sheets, in dashboards, or via AI Copilot.

Chat to report

Let clients generate reports by simply asking in plain English. No training, no technical setup required.

Social proof

Every claim has a receipt.

Stats with comment threads attached — like a colleague verifying your numbers in a shared sheet.

170,000
Users on OWOX Platform — and growing 40% year-over-year.
B2
cell "users on platform"
SM
Sarah M.
Head of Analytics, Retail
3d ago

We migrated 200+ reports from Looker to OWOX Data Marts. Our team now self-serves without filing a single Jira ticket. Easily the best infrastructure decision we made this year.

✓ Verified
12 min
Median time-to-first-report for new OWOX users. No onboarding calls required.
C4
cell "time to first report"
DL
David L.
Data Lead, SaaS
Sarah M.

Connected BigQuery, set up 37 data marts, built a data model and had live reports in Sheets in under 15 minutes. My team thought I was joking when I showed them how they can now get live reports right in their sheets.

✓ Verified
FAQ

Frequently asked questions

What's the difference between the push workflow and the extension?
+
Can I include joined columns from Joinable Data Marts in a Sheet?
+
How does the "Available for Reports" governance work?
+
Which editions include this?
+
How fresh is the data?
+
Is Excel supported?
+

Ready to report from the tool your team already uses?

Push governed Data Marts to Sheets on a schedule — or let business users self-serve from inside the spreadsheet.